CVE-2025-22558 is classified as a medium-severity vulnerability due to an improper neutralization of input during web page generation, specifically allowing stored Cross-site Scripting (XSS) in the Marcus C. J. Hartmann mcjh button shortcode plugin. This vulnerability impacts versions from n/a through 1.6.4 and could lead to serious implications for users of the affected software.
The severity of this vulnerability is reflected in its CVSS score of 6.5, which indicates a medium level of risk. Organizations should take note of the potential for exploitation, particularly in environments where user input is not adequately sanitized.
As of the latest updates, the exploitation status of this vulnerability is deferred, meaning there has not been a confirmed exploit in the wild, though it remains critical for organizations to remain vigilant.
Organizations should prioritize patching the mcjh button shortcode plugin to mitigate any potential risks associated with this vulnerability and ensure their web applications are secure.
Vulnerability Details
This vulnerability allows stored XSS through improper handling of user input in the mcjh button shortcode plugin.
The CVSS score of 6.5 indicates that while the risk is medium, organizations must still act to remediate this vulnerability promptly.
Technical Analysis
The root cause of this vulnerability lies in the inadequate sanitization of user input during web page generation, leading to the potential for stored XSS attacks.
An attacker could exploit this vulnerability through network vectors, requiring low privileges and user interaction to execute the attack.
Risk & Impact Analysis
Risk to organizations includes the potential for unauthorized access to sensitive user data, as well as the possibility of further infection within interconnected systems.
The blast radius of this vulnerability can be significant, especially for organizations that rely heavily on web applications for user interactions.
Exploitation Status
Signal | Status |
|---|---|
Known Exploit | No |
Public PoC | No |
Actively Exploited | No |
Ransomware Use | No |
Affected Versions
The mcjh button shortcode plugin is affected from n/a through 1.6.4. Organizations using this plugin should ensure they are updated to the latest version to mitigate the risk.
Mitigation & Remediation
Organizations should prioritize patching immediately. It is crucial to upgrade the mcjh button shortcode plugin to the latest version to close this vulnerability.
In the meantime, organizations can implement input validation and output encoding as workarounds to mitigate the risk of XSS attacks.
Detection Guidance
Monitoring logs for unusual user behavior and reviewing changes made to web pages can help detect exploitation attempts.
AppSecure Threat Intelligence Insight
The long-term significance of CVE-2025-22558 highlights the importance of continuous security assessments and the need for organizations to adopt proactive measures in their development processes.
This incident serves as a reminder for security teams to prioritize secure coding practices and to regularly review third-party plugin security.
Organizations are encouraged to implement regular vulnerability assessments and penetration testing to identify and remediate weaknesses proactively.
Disclaimer: This content was generated using AI. While we strive for accuracy, please verify critical information with official sources.

.webp)